H.RES.1154: Expressing support for designation of September 13, 2010, as "National Childhood Cancer Awareness Day".

Bill Summary
Expresses support for the designation of National Childhood Cancer Awareness Day. Pledges to make the prevention and cure of cancer a public health priority. Urges public and private sector efforts to promote awareness, invest in research, and improve treatments for childhood cancer.
(Source: Library of Congress)
